Riboswitch is a mechanism of gene activity regulation by mRNA conformation. Riboswitch can regulate ______.
Select one:
a. transcription
b. translation
c. both transcription and translation
d. neither transcription nor translation
Answer c. both transcription and translation
Riboswitch regulates the gene expression. They are RNA elements and they binds with small molecules. Hence they can know about the intracellular concentration of those molecules. The ribo switch regulates its adjacent genes by altering its transcription and translation
